✅ Society Do’s & Don’ts
Published on 4 November 2025

✔ Do’s
- Maintain cleanliness in common areas and parks.
- Follow parking rules and park only in your designated area.
- Cooperate with security staff and follow gate-entry protocols.
- Dispose of waste properly — use dry/wet dustbins as instructed.
- Keep noise levels low, especially early mornings and late evenings.
- Respect neighbours’ privacy and personal space.
- Report any maintenance or safety issues to the RWA promptly.
- Encourage safe and responsible play for children in designated areas.
✘ Don’ts
- Do not throw garbage or water from balconies or windows.
- Do not park in someone else's parking space or block pathways.
- Do not play loud music or create disturbances during silent hours.
- Do not damage common property, plants, equipment, or park facilities.
- Do not allow unverified visitors or delivery personnel inside blocks.
- Do not use lifts for construction materials or heavy loads without prior permission.
- Do not dry clothes in common corridors, staircases, or shared spaces.
- Do not feed stray animals inside building premises unless in designated areas.
- Do not argue with security or housekeeping staff — contact the RWA for concerns.
- Do not organise personal gatherings in common areas without RWA approval.
